Различия
Здесь показаны различия между двумя версиями данной страницы.
| Следующая версия | Предыдущая версия | ||
|
wiki:руководство_по_ubuntu_server:приложения_lamp:overview [2012/07/23 20:11] создано |
wiki:руководство_по_ubuntu_server:приложения_lamp:overview [2012/07/23 22:29] (текущий) [Обзор] |
||
|---|---|---|---|
| Строка 6: | Строка 6: | ||
| [[wiki:руководство_по_ubuntu_server:приложения_lamp:moin_moin|далее->]]</style> | [[wiki:руководство_по_ubuntu_server:приложения_lamp:moin_moin|далее->]]</style> | ||
| + | =====Обзор===== | ||
| + | |||
| + | Установка LAMP (Linux + Apache + MySQL + PHP/Perl/Python) является популярным вариантом настройки серверов Ubuntu. Существует множество приложений с открытым кодом, написанных с использованием стека приложений LAMP. Популярными приложениями LAMP являются wiki энциклопедии, системы управления содержимым (CMS) и управляющие приложения, такие как phpMyAdmin. | ||
| + | |||
| + | Одним из преимуществ LAMP является значительная гибкость в выборе различных баз данных, web серверов и языков сценариев. Популярной заменой для MySQL служат PostgreSQL и SQLite. Python, Perl и Ruby также часто заменяют PHP. А Nginx, Cherokee и Lighttpd могут заменять Apache. | ||
| + | |||
| + | Самым быстрым способом установить LAMP является использование **tasksel**. Tasksel - это инструмент Debian/Ubuntu, который устанавливает несколько зависимых пакетов в вашу систему в качестве единой задачи. Для установки LAMP сервера: | ||
| + | |||
| + | -- В терминале введите следующую команду: | ||
| + | <code>sudo tasksel install lamp-server</code> | ||
| + | |||
| + | После установки вы можете поставить большинство LAMP приложений следующим образом: | ||
| + | -- Загрузите архив, содержащий файлы с исходным кодом приложения. | ||
| + | -- Распакуйте архив в каталог, доступный web серверу. | ||
| + | -- В зависимости от того, куда распакованы файлы, настройте web сервер на их обработку. | ||
| + | -- Настройте приложение на доступ к базе данных. | ||
| + | -- Выполните сценарий (script) или загрузите страницу приложения для установки базы данных, необходимой приложению. | ||
| + | -- Когда шаги, указанные выше или подобные им, выполнены, вы готовы начать использовать приложение. | ||
| + | |||
| + | Неудобство использования такого подхода заключается в нестандартном способе установки файлов приложения на файловую систему, что может привести к беспорядку в выборе мест установки приложений. Другим большим неудобством является обновление приложений. При выпуске новой версии, этот же процесс используется для установки обновляемого приложения. | ||
| + | |||
| + | К счастью ряд приложений LAMP уже упакованы для Ubuntu и доступны для установки так же, как и обычные (не-LAMP) приложения. Однако для некоторых таких приложений могут потребоваться дополнительные шаги по установке и настройке. | ||
| + | |||
| + | Этот раздел показывает как установить некоторые приложения LAMP. | ||
| + | |||
| + | ---- | ||
| + | |||
| + | <style float-right> | ||
| + | [[wiki:руководство_по_ubuntu_server:приложения_lamp|<-назад]] | | ||
| + | [[wiki:руководство_по_ubuntu_server:приложения_lamp:moin_moin|далее->]]</style> | ||